基于FPGA的多功能正弦信号发生器 被引量:2

Multi-functional Sine Signal Generator Based on FPGA Technology

摘要 系统以FPGA和单片机为核心,辅以必要的模拟电路,构成了一个基于DDS技术的正弦信号发生器.其主要模块有正弦波生成、频率控制、幅度控制、D/A转换和后级处理以实现AM、FM、ASK、PSK、FSK等功能.各模块均通过VH DL语言编程在FPGA上实现;后级处理采用低通滤波器和功率放大电路来提高波形质量和负载能力,最终得到所要求的多功能正弦信号发生器,在现代通信中具有良好的使用性. This system based on FPGA, MCU and the essential simulated circuit, forms a signal generator of Sin wave based on DDS technology. The main module is made of the generator of sinusoidal wave, frequency control, range control, D/A convert and the functions such as AM, FM, ASK, PSK, FSK, etc.. Each module is realized by using VHDL; It raises wave qualities through low- pass filter and power amplifier. We get a required multifunctional sina signal generator finally, these functions have variable use in modern communication.
出处 《淮北煤炭师范学院学报(自然科学版)》 2006年第3期34-39,共6页 Journal of Huaibei Coal Industry Teachers College(Natural Science edition)
关键词 正弦信号 FPGA DDS 单片机 sina signal FPGA DDS, MCU
